If the observations are not independent then the one way anova is an inappropriate statistic. Typically a one way anova is used when you have three or more categorical independent groups but it can be used for just two groups but an independent samples t test is more commonly used for two groups. Assumption of homogeneity of variance.

Normality that each sample is taken from a normally distributed population sample independence that each sample has been drawn independently of the other samples variance equality that the variance of data in the different groups should be the same.

The motivation for performing a one way anova. Assumption of homogeneity of variance. Equal variances the variances of the populations that the samples come from are equal. A one way anova uses one independent variable while a two way anova uses two independent variables.
